@import "https://fonts.googleapis.com/css2?family=JetBrains+Mono:wght@400;500;600;700&display=swap";
*{box-sizing:border-box;margin:0;padding:0}html,body{scroll-behavior:smooth;width:100%;height:100%}:root{--surface:#faf8f3;--surface-dim:#f3efe8;--surface-bright:#fff;--surface-container-lowest:#fff;--surface-container-low:#fbf8f2;--surface-container:#f4efe7;--surface-container-high:#ede7dc;--surface-container-highest:#e6dfd2;--on-surface:#171717;--on-surface-variant:#595959;--outline:#cec6b7;--outline-variant:#ded6c7;--primary:#111;--on-primary:#fff;--primary-container:#111;--on-primary-container:#fff;--secondary:#6d6254;--on-secondary:#fff;--secondary-container:#e9e1d3;--error:#b42318;--on-error:#fff;--background:#faf8f3;--on-background:#171717;--unit:4px;--gutter:16px;--margin:24px;--section-gap:32px}.dark{--surface:#0f0f0f;--surface-dim:#1a1a1a;--surface-bright:#242424;--surface-container-lowest:#050505;--surface-container-low:#121212;--surface-container:#1c1c1c;--surface-container-high:#262626;--surface-container-highest:#303030;--on-surface:#e6e6e6;--on-surface-variant:#a0a0a0;--outline:#3d3d3d;--outline-variant:#4a4a4a;--primary:#fff;--on-primary:#000;--primary-container:#fff;--on-primary-container:#000;--secondary:#a69a8c;--on-secondary:#000;--secondary-container:#2c2925;--error:#f04438;--on-error:#fff;--background:#0a0a0a;--on-background:#e6e6e6}body{background-color:var(--background);color:var(--on-background);background-attachment:fixed;font-family:JetBrains Mono,monospace;font-size:14px;font-weight:400;line-height:20px;position:relative}h1{letter-spacing:-.02em;margin-bottom:var(--margin);font-family:JetBrains Mono,monospace;font-size:28px;font-weight:700;line-height:32px}h2{letter-spacing:-.01em;margin-bottom:calc(var(--margin) - 8px);font-family:JetBrains Mono,monospace;font-size:20px;font-weight:600;line-height:24px}h3{margin-bottom:var(--gutter);font-family:JetBrains Mono,monospace;font-size:14px;font-weight:600;line-height:20px}p{margin-bottom:var(--gutter);color:var(--on-surface)}a{color:var(--primary);text-decoration:none;transition:color .15s ease-in-out}a:hover{color:var(--primary);text-decoration:underline}section{scroll-margin-top:110px}main{width:100%;max-width:896px;padding:96px var(--gutter) 40px;margin:0 auto}hr{border:none;border-top:1px solid var(--outline-variant);margin:var(--section-gap) 0}.btn{border:1px solid var(--primary);color:var(--primary);cursor:pointer;background-color:#0000;padding:8px 16px;font-family:JetBrains Mono,monospace;font-size:14px;font-weight:500;transition:all .15s ease-in-out;display:inline-block}.btn:hover{background-color:var(--primary);color:var(--on-primary)}.btn:active{opacity:.8}code{background-color:var(--surface-container-low);color:var(--primary);padding:2px 6px;font-family:JetBrains Mono,monospace;font-size:13px}pre{background-color:var(--surface-container-low);padding:var(--gutter);margin-bottom:var(--margin);border:1px solid var(--outline-variant);overflow-x:auto}pre code{color:var(--on-surface);background-color:#0000;padding:0}.text-muted{color:var(--on-surface-variant)}.text-accent{color:var(--primary)}.divider-horizontal{background-color:var(--outline-variant);height:1px;margin:var(--section-gap) 0}.grid{gap:var(--margin);display:grid}.flex{align-items:center;gap:var(--gutter);display:flex}
